#401387 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#401387 is composed of 25.1% red, 7.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.6%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 263.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 30.2%. #401387 color hex could be obtained by blending #8026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#401387

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07020f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#401387

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4852 is the less saturated color, while #3c0199 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#401387 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#2e2e2e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#322940 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#003b74 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#003f65 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#2d4045 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#172d7b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#172f71 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#342f5d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
